I need some info on a Spicer 6453 transmission common on the bigger 5 Ton military trucks...anyone familiar with them? My Autocar had a Spicer 6452 direct drive. My trucks never going back into serious work & so I decided to swap it for the 6453 which I was told was identical except gear ratios were faster & 5th gear OD instead of direct on the 6452.
So theres 4 or 5 fittings on the shift cover with plastic plugs in them. The 6452 doesnst have this & I have no idea what theyre for??
Any help greatly appreciated.
Here’s a picture of a 6453. Note the plastic cap plugs...what gets plumbed into here...what does it do & where can I get a schematic?
